Three concrete AI opportunities with ROI framing

1. Intelligent clinical documentation. Therapists spend up to 30% of their day on notes and admin. Ambient AI scribes that listen to sessions (with consent) and generate structured SOAP notes can reclaim 5–10 hours per clinician per week. For a staff of 150 clinicians, that’s over 7,500 hours annually—equivalent to 3.5 FTEs—redirected to client care. ROI is immediate through increased billable hours and reduced overtime.

2. Predictive risk and engagement models. By analyzing historical appointment data, demographics, and clinical assessments, machine learning can flag clients likely to miss appointments or disengage. Early intervention via care coordinators can boost retention by 15–20%, improving outcomes and securing value-based reimbursement. For a nonprofit reliant on grant metrics, this also strengthens reporting.

3. Automated revenue cycle management. Denied claims cost behavioral health providers 5–10% of revenue. AI-driven coding assistance and denial prediction can cut that in half. For Wellnest’s estimated $35M revenue, a 3% improvement yields over $1M annually—funds that can be reinvested into programs.

Deployment risks specific to this size band

Mid-sized nonprofits often lack dedicated IT and data science teams, making vendor selection critical. Over-customizing or building in-house can strain resources; instead, opt for configurable, HIPAA-compliant platforms with strong support. Data quality is another hurdle: fragmented EHRs and inconsistent entry undermine AI accuracy. Start with a data hygiene initiative. Change management is paramount—clinicians may distrust AI, fearing surveillance or job loss. Transparent communication, union engagement (if applicable), and co-design workshops build trust. Finally, ethical AI governance must be embedded from day one to avoid bias in risk models that could disproportionately affect marginalized communities. Frequently asked

Common questions about AI for mental health care

How can AI reduce clinician burnout at Wellnest?
By automating note-taking and administrative tasks, AI frees up clinicians to focus on direct client care, reducing documentation fatigue.
What data privacy risks exist with AI in mental health?
PHI must be de-identified and encrypted; on-premise or HIPAA-compliant cloud deployments mitigate exposure, but robust governance is essential.
Can AI help Wellnest secure more grants?
Yes, AI-powered outcome analytics provide compelling, data-rich narratives that strengthen grant applications and demonstrate impact.
What’s the first step toward AI adoption for a mid-sized nonprofit?
Start with a low-risk pilot like automated scheduling or documentation assistance, then scale based on measurable ROI and staff feedback.
Will AI replace therapists?
No, AI augments clinicians by handling repetitive tasks; the human therapeutic relationship remains irreplaceable and central to care.
How do we ensure AI tools are equitable?
Train models on diverse datasets, audit for bias, and involve community stakeholders in design to avoid perpetuating disparities.
What integration challenges might we face with our EHR?
Legacy EHRs may lack APIs; consider middleware or phased migration to cloud-native platforms that support AI plug-ins.
